The whole NSW fleet is was run by the "Automotive-Plant" section in Sydney with about 15 country based fleet managers in regional centers. I covered the area from Campbeltown, near Sydney, to the Victorian border [& beyond] & west as far as Young.
I had the coastal area from north of Wollongong, south to Batemans Bay & my fleet , at about 650 units, was 50% bigger than the next biggest group.

In all of that, there was no real economic justification for the use of LSD in Nissan Bluebirds. I tried to justify one on the grounds that i spent quite some time in the winter months in the snowfields using ice covered roads as an avenue for an excuse. They pointed out that i had spent the previous 5 years there without incident, so there was no DEMONSTRABLE need. Bummer.
They were right, we never had a demonstrable need in all the time that we had Datsuns starting with the 200B wagons in 1980 untill the last Bluebird went from my fleet in '91.

The Detroit locker that i placed in a Falcon Van was death on wheels & unless you have driven one of these things, while understanding how they work, you could never grasp how violently they can make a car change lanes in a turn just by depressing the clutch to change gear. They need a skilled driver to get the best from them & i wasn't prepared to risk it in the fleet.

S110 silvias with Z20E's definately have H1665 differentials and LSD's were an option. In S12 they again were an option in poverty pack models. The big guns (FJ20T and CA18DET) all had independant rear ends with R200 LSD's.N/A FJ20's had R180's as an option.

Dodgeman, maybe southern NSW management was too tight to spend a dollar to save two dollars.

SEC (State Electricity Commissionin Vic) also used them as an alternative to 4WD vehicles in some applications. This info came from a friend who worked in Nissan fleet sales in durability testing.

As the former Telecom fleet manager for a chunk of south east NSW, i can assure you that no Nissan Bluebirds in the years 1981 to about 1985 ever came with LSD's in the NSW fleet. I tried to get one for my series 2 [which replaced my series 1] & i had input to the top of the management heap [we were apprentices together] but NO DEAL.

I got a Detroit Locker for my Falcon Panel van, but that was for a special development programme that i devised. Those things are pure evil on the street & it was NOT recomended.
